A hyphen is the short line (-) used to join words together or separate syllables, such as in 'mother-in-law' or 're-enter'.
الاستخدام والفروق الدقيقة
A hyphen is not the same as a dash (– or —), which is longer. Commonly used in compound words, splitting words at line breaks, and some phone numbers. Don't confuse with underscore (_) or minus sign.
